Integrated Development - Published: 30 Sep 2004
Integrated Development is development where licences/approvals/permits are needed from specified State Government Agencies as well as requiring Council consent. These applications are referred to the relevant state body who will provide Council with terms and conditions for inclusion in any development consent. more ..

Designated and State Significant - Published: 15 Jul 2004
Designated Development generally comprises projects which have been nominated for particular scrutiny due to potentially significant environmental concerns (such as mines or large piggeries). All Designated Development requires development consent before it can be carried out. An Environmental Impact Statement must also be prepared and lodged by the applicant.

State Significant Development is development involving major projects of State or Regional significance. Applications for State Significant Development are to be lodged with and assessed and determined by the Department of Urban Affairs and Planning.
